Transaction 23f901d41e7d31171e88d2570a66714cd0f0879f9a3a5584e2e9d1a2063c8ed6
1 Input
1 Output
-
23f901d41e7d31171e88d2570a66714cd0f0879f9a3a5584e2e9d1a2063c8ed6:0
- value
- 582613
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bbd07240d36a19d375e0dc327929e93d153cdf00 OP_EQUAL
- address
- 3Jp5zX48PgRbNZHefKDT9QbjzB7bD8w86Y